This week, exciting developments from NASA's Curiosity rover have ignited fresh interest in the quest for life on Mars. The rover has uncovered organic carbon compounds in Martian rocks, leading scientists to reconsider the planet's potential to host life, and what this might mean for our understanding of biology beyond Earth.

New Findings from the Red Planet

The Curiosity rover, which has been exploring the surface of Mars since 2012, has made groundbreaking discoveries that suggest the past presence of life. The significant finding of 21 organic molecules, including seven not previously detected on Mars, reveals a nitrogen-rich structure akin to the building blocks of RNA and DNA. This anomaly represents a pivotal clue in the ongoing search for extraterrestrial life.

Why These Discoveries Matter Now

The implications of finding organic carbon on Mars are profound. Understanding whether these compounds are indicative of ancient microbial life or merely the result of non-biological processes is crucial. As technology advances, researchers are better equipped to examine such findings, making this a timely and critical juncture in the field of astrobiology.

The Role of Technology in Space Exploration

Today's technological advancements enable more sophisticated exploration of Mars than ever before. The data transmitted back from the Curiosity rover allows scientists to analyze Martian soil and rock samples with unprecedented detail. This increased clarity helps researchers draw connections between organic compounds and potential life forms.
